See DetailsAirbrushes have become an essential tool in various fields, ranging from art and cosmetics to automotive painting and model building. These tools offer unique advantages over traditional spraying methods, especially when it comes to precision and the quality of the finish. The ability to control the airflow and the amount of paint applied allows for a level of detail that traditional tools may struggle to achieve. In this article, we will compare airbrushes with traditional tools in terms of spraying precision and effect, highlighting their differences and the advantages of each in different applications.
An airbrush is a small, hand-held device that uses compressed air to spray paint or other liquids. The device consists of a nozzle, a needle, and a trigger mechanism, which together allow the user to control the flow of the liquid. The precision of the airbrush lies in its ability to adjust the spray pattern, ranging from a fine mist to a wider spray. This flexibility allows for a high degree of control over the application of paint, making it an ideal choice for tasks that require fine detailing and smooth, even coverage.
Airbrushes are typically used with a compressor that provides the necessary air pressure to atomize the paint and create a consistent spray pattern. By adjusting the pressure and the nozzle size, users can achieve various effects, from soft gradients to sharp, detailed lines. This adaptability makes the airbrush highly versatile, suitable for everything from intricate artwork to professional-grade automotive painting.
Traditional spraying tools, such as paintbrushes, rollers, and spray guns, have been used for centuries in a variety of applications. Each of these tools has its specific use cases and limitations. For example, a paintbrush is ideal for small-scale, detailed work, but it cannot match the efficiency and coverage that a spray gun can provide on larger surfaces. Similarly, rollers are excellent for large, flat areas, but they lack the precision required for intricate designs or patterns.
Traditional spray guns, which operate through compressed air similar to an airbrush, are often used in industrial settings where large quantities of paint need to be applied quickly and efficiently. These tools tend to have a wider spray pattern, which makes them less ideal for delicate work but excellent for covering larger surfaces. Unlike airbrushes, traditional spray guns do not typically offer the same level of precision, especially for fine details.
When it comes to spraying precision, airbrushes stand out due to their ability to produce highly controlled and fine sprays. The nozzle and needle mechanism in an airbrush can be adjusted to create a spray that is much finer than what can be achieved with a traditional spray gun. This makes airbrushes ideal for detailed tasks, such as portrait painting, tattoo art, or automotive pinstriping, where a high level of control is necessary.
Traditional tools, such as brushes and rollers, typically do not offer the same level of precision. Brushes are limited by the bristle pattern and the artist’s hand control, making them less effective for smooth, even coverage, especially over large areas. While traditional spray guns can cover large surfaces quickly, they lack the finesse needed for fine detailing. The wide spray pattern of a traditional spray gun often leads to overspray, which is a challenge when working on intricate designs or fine lines.
The precision offered by an airbrush is particularly beneficial in applications such as model building or makeup artistry, where minute details can make a significant difference. In contrast, traditional tools are more suitable for broader, less detailed work, such as painting large walls or furniture, where speed and coverage are more important than precision.
The effect of the spray is another critical factor in comparing airbrushes with traditional tools. Airbrushes, due to their fine spray pattern and adjustable flow, produce an extremely smooth finish that is difficult to replicate with traditional tools. The ability to control the air pressure and paint flow allows for subtle gradients, shading, and transitions, which is why airbrushes are commonly used in airbrushed art, automotive painting, and cosmetics, where a smooth and flawless finish is desired.
In contrast, traditional tools like paintbrushes and rollers can often leave visible strokes or roller marks on the surface, especially if the paint is applied too thickly or unevenly. While these tools are effective for large-scale coverage, they do not offer the same level of smoothness and finish that an airbrush can provide. Traditional spray guns, on the other hand, can achieve a smooth finish on larger surfaces, but the spray tends to be less fine than that of an airbrush, resulting in a less even coating in some cases.
One key benefit of traditional tools is their ability to apply a thicker coat of paint in a single pass. For projects that require a heavy build-up of paint, such as priming surfaces or applying base coats, traditional spray guns or brushes may be more efficient. However, for projects that require a smooth, flawless finish with minimal texture, an airbrush is generally the better option.
While airbrushes excel in precision and finish, they are typically slower than traditional tools, especially when it comes to covering larger areas. Airbrushes are best suited for detailed work, and their small size and focused spray pattern mean that they take longer to cover a surface compared to traditional spray guns. In industrial settings or large-scale projects, traditional tools like spray guns are preferred for their speed and ability to quickly cover large surfaces with minimal effort.
Traditional spray guns can apply paint much faster, making them more efficient for large-scale projects such as automotive painting, house painting, or industrial applications. These tools are designed for high-volume work, and their larger spray patterns and greater paint flow allow them to cover large areas in a short amount of time. However, while traditional spray guns are faster, they often require additional work to achieve the same level of detail and smoothness that an airbrush can deliver in a shorter time frame.
In the world of cosmetics, for example, where precision and quick application are essential, airbrushes are commonly used for their ability to apply foundation, blush, and other makeup products evenly and smoothly. Traditional makeup tools like brushes and sponges, while effective for blending, cannot match the precision or speed of an airbrush when it comes to achieving a flawless finish in a short amount of time.
When comparing airbrushes to traditional tools, cost is an important consideration. Airbrushes, being more specialized tools, tend to be more expensive than traditional spray guns or brushes. The initial investment in an airbrush setup, which includes the airbrush itself, a compressor, and specialized paints, can be quite high. However, for those who require high precision and detailed work, the cost of an airbrush may be justified by the quality of the results.
On the other hand, traditional tools like paintbrushes, rollers, and spray guns are generally more affordable and easier to maintain. For large-scale painting projects where precision is not as critical, traditional tools offer a more cost-effective solution. While they may not provide the same level of detail as an airbrush, they are suitable for a wide range of applications where speed and coverage are prioritized over fine detailing.
